Setting up a nursery can feel overwhelming. With endless product lists and trendy baby items, it’s hard to know what’s truly necessary. The truth is: you don’t need everything — just the right essentials that keep your baby safe, comfortable, and make daily care easier.
This guide breaks down the must-have nursery essentials for new parents, focusing on what you’ll actually use in the first months.
Choose a crib or bassinet that:
Meets current safety standards
Has a firm mattress
Fits your available space
Many parents start with a bassinet for the first few months, then transition to a crib.
Firm, flat mattress only
2–3 fitted crib sheets (extras help with nighttime messes)
❌ Avoid loose bedding, pillows, and crib bumpers.
You don’t need a separate changing table if you have:
A sturdy dresser
A contoured changing pad
Keep these within arm’s reach:
Diapers (newborn + size 1)
Unscented wipes
Diaper cream
Changing pad covers
A soft night light makes nighttime feedings and diaper changes easier without fully waking your baby.
Look for:
Warm light
Dimmable settings
LED (cool to the touch)

Even before baby is mobile, it’s smart to prepare:
Outlet covers
Furniture wall anchors
Cord organizers
The ideal nursery temperature is 68–72°F (20–22°C).
Humidifier (especially in dry climates)
HEPA air purifier (fragrance-free)

Many items are nice-to-have but not essential:
Wipe warmers
Bottle sterilizers (dishwasher often works)
Fancy décor items
Excessive toys
You can always add these later.
